Just 50 feet from the sandy beach of Drios, To Kyma offers self-catering and tastefully decorated studios and apartments with views over the Aegean Sea. Free WiFi is available in all areas.
Opening to a balcony, all the studios and apartments are air conditioned and have a kitchenette with mini fridge. Guests can start their day with the breakfast in their unit. Homemade jam, olive oil and red wine are provided upon arrival.
To Kyma has a relaxed, family atmosphere. It promises a relaxing stay in one of the most beautiful islands of the Aegean. Free private parking is possible at a nearby location.
